Rick,

I full well feel the same as all here. This has to be one of the two
biggest failures to date in product fulfillment.
We had shown a working built in high speed receiver sweep at Dayton about
?? 5-6 ?? years ago in an Orion II. And stated that we would do the same in
the OMNI-VII. Missed many dates on this one.
Now, the standpoint is, publicly, no promises of date or timing or
completion can be discussed publicly. To coin a phrase that is a little
rough.
We either have to piss or get off the pot... Simple, crude, I apologize,
but nothing says it getter.
This means 1 of two things will happen.
1 - at some point in time, we will announce the introduction of the
product, and the definition of the product. Logically, the first form might
be for the 588 to give the 588 customers a "visual second receiver". But if
we are going to finish this, it has to have some starting point product
introduction to get customer satisfaction and appeal back in this area.
or, if we totally fail, and I am not one to take failure lightly
2 - at some point in time we will announce that we will not introduce such
a product.

We realize that built in receive sweeps may be a MUST have for future
competitive rigs. In order to get it into future rigs we must first prove
we can do it in a current stable rig and learn from it on how to make it
better.
So the pressure is so very high to make this product succeed.
The "product" had always been discussed as an internal panadapter.
No promise of an external.

I hope my "non commitment" answer above is understood.
